For the equilibrium
`NiO(s)+CO(g) hArr Ni(s)+CO_(2)(g)`
`DeltaG^(ɵ) (J mol^(-1))=-20700-11.97 T`. Calculate the temperature at which the product gases at equilibrium at `1` atm will contain `400` ppm of carbon monoxide.
